Learning Outcomes

- Student will be able to do general accounting, reliably and legally.
- Student can use computer-based accounting.
- Student are able to produce cost and investment calculations using fundamental accounting concepts and essential accounting models.
- Students can analyze a company’s final statement and evaluate it’s profitability, economic and decision-making status.

Assessment Criteria

Excellent (5)
Student can independently take care of the accounting of a small business and can manage demanding managemet accounting tasks.
Good (4-3)
Student can independently take care of the basic tasks of accounting in small business and can manage basic managemet accounting tasks.
Satisfactory (2-1)
Student can take care of the basic tasks of accounting in small business and can manage basic managemet accounting tasks under supervision.
